ISI Kolkata offers a two-year Master of Mathematics. The institute does not charge anything for this programme. So, students do not need to pay anything as tuition fees. When it comes to hostel fees, students need to pay only a refundable caution deposit of Rs 5,000. They also need to pay a recurring mess charge. The mess charges at ISI Kolkata change from academic year to academic year.

The Master of Statistics (M.Stat.) programme offered at the Indian Statistical Institute (ISI), Kolkata is one of the best statistics programmes that can be pursued in India and also highly-sought after.

The fee structure for M.Stat at ISI Kolkata are as given below:

Application Fee: Rs. 1,250 (for General category); Rs. 625 (for reserved category)

Course Fee: There is no course fee for pursuing an M.Stat course from ISI Kolkata

Stipend: Students get a stipend of Rs. 5,000 per month

Hostel Charges: A nominal room rent of Rs. 300 per month has to be paid in addition to refundable one-time hostel and mess charges.

Mess Charges: The mess charges are variable according to your dietary preferences.
